ARTIFACT: This is an extremely rare Goodyear airship pilot hat badge in sterling silver made by Whitehead & Hoag. The badge is a pair of spread wings with a diamond-shaped lozenge at center displaying a blue and yellow flag.

It is possible that this wartime-produced hat badge was worn by Goodyear Pilot's in the capacity of training US Navy Airship / Blimp pilots. 

VINTAGE: Circa 1930's -early 1940's.

SIZE: 2" in height x 2" in width.

MATERIALS / CONSTRUCTION: Gilt sterling with blue and yellow enamel.

ATTACHMENT: Two screw posts with disc backings.

MARKINGS: STERLING with Circled WH Whitehead & Hoag maker's mark.
